Latest Patents
One of his latest innovations is the Bench-top Time of Flight Mass Spectrometer. This invention features an automatic start-up routine that is initiated upon switching on the mass spectrometer. The device comprises multiple functional modules, each designed to perform specific tasks. The start-up routine detects which modules are connected and executes necessary steps based on this detection. Furthermore, the mass spectrometer can determine if configuration information is stored locally for each detected module. If local information is available, it is used for configuration. If not, the device automatically retrieves the required configuration data from a remote server, ensuring optimal performance.
